Why I Love This Space: I love this space's mix in furnishings

This space is the definition of eclectic design. The space features pieces from all different periods. When you have a space that has so many different styles the walls should be painted white. You don't want the space to feel too busy or the design to conflict. One piece that I'm not a fan of is the square pedestal to the left. As the bottom of the pedestal the paint is beginning to peel off. It detracts from the space, and makes it appear dirty. I also would have liked to have seen the brown armchair to the left being reupholstered and painted at the bottom. Do you like the space? Why I Love This Space: I love this space's modern design, area rug, and darker floors

Not having upper cabinets is something that is becoming more and more popular in contemporary homes. By not having upper cabinets, one eliminates clutter, and the space opens up. The area rug brings some much need color and texture into the space and softens the modern look of the kitchen. Because the walls and most of the pieces are white, a darker floor really makes a statement. It also makes the cabinetry stand out. If the floors were stained a lighter color, the white cabinets would not be such a focus. Do you see yourself cooking here? You can add as little or as much to your space as you want.
